Pool Plaster Basics and Expected Lifespan

What Pool Plaster Does

Pool plaster is a thin, cement-based coating – measuring about 1/4 to 1/2 inch thick – that serves several purposes. First, it waterproofs the pool shell, safeguarding the underlying concrete or gunite structure from damage [7]. It also creates a smooth, swimmer-friendly surface, enhances the pool’s overall appearance with a variety of colors and textures, and helps maintain balanced water chemistry by resisting biofilm and algae buildup [1]. Keeping this protective layer in good condition is essential to avoid the issues we’ll discuss later.

Expected Lifespan of Pool Plaster

When properly cared for, pool plaster can last anywhere from 7 to 15 years [2][4][6]. However, if you live in Miami-Dade, the story might be different. The area’s intense UV rays, high humidity, warm water temperatures, and frequent storms can shorten the lifespan to just 5–7 years [6].

"Miami’s UV exposure, warm water, and frequent storms accelerate surface wear, leading to stains, etching, rough texture, and cracks." – Alligator Pools [1]

Visible Cracks in the Surface

Hairline cracks (less than 1/8 inch wide) might seem minor, but they can deepen into structural cracks (big enough to slide a credit card into), which can compromise your pool’s seal and lead to leaks [2][4].

"Hairline surface cracks (under 1/8 inch) are cosmetic. Cracks you can fit a credit card into? That’s structural damage requiring immediate attention before your pool leaks hundreds of gallons daily." – John Chavez, Founder, Sublime Pools & Spa [4]

Signs like delamination (a hollow sound when you tap the surface) or pitting (small craters) suggest the plaster is separating from the concrete or being damaged by chemicals [4][8][9]. These cracks often lead to a rougher pool surface, which is another red flag.

Rough or Bumpy Surface Texture

Does your pool surface feel rough like sandpaper? If it leaves a white, chalky residue on your hands, that’s a sign of deeper problems [4]. This rough texture isn’t just uncomfortable – it can cause scrapes, cuts, and even snagged swimsuits [4][9].

Rough patches also create a haven for algae. Tiny craters trap dirt, debris, and organic material, making it nearly impossible to keep the surface clean, no matter how much brushing or chemical treatment you use [1].

Fading, Discoloration, and Persistent Stains

A faded pool finish or stubborn stains that won’t go away indicate that the protective seal is breaking down [4]. Once this happens, chemicals can no longer restore the surface to its original appearance.

"Staining that won’t budge signals surface breakdown. When metals and minerals penetrate deteriorating plaster, no amount of acid washing helps." – Sublime Pools & Spa [4]

Discoloration also creates porous areas where algae can take hold, making it harder to maintain a sanitary pool.

Chalking, Flaking, or Peeling

A white, powdery residue (known as chalking) is an early warning sign that your plaster is deteriorating. Flaking or peeling (spalling) is an even clearer indication that the damage is beyond repair and replastering is urgently needed [3][4][8].

"When pool surfaces start to fail, the first place you may notice it is around the steps or floor. Flaking or peeling plaster in these areas is known as spalling." – Eagle Pool Service [8]

Shockingly, about 70% of pool owners wait until their pool reaches this stage of failure, leading to skyrocketing repair costs [4].

Unexplained Water Loss

If your pool is losing more than 1/4 inch of water per day (beyond normal evaporation), it could mean cracks in the plaster are allowing water to seep into the concrete below [3][2][4][9][8]. This kind of structural damage is already underway, so constant refilling is a clear sign you need a professional inspection.

Problems Balancing Water Chemistry

Are you constantly adjusting your pool’s pH? Deteriorating plaster could be releasing calcium into the water, throwing off the chemical balance and speeding up surface wear [4]. This imbalance not only wastes up to 30% more chemicals but also worsens the underlying problem [4]. Pitting often accompanies these chemical issues, marking another stage of surface failure.

Pitting and Surface Erosion

Small pits and craters caused by chemical or mineral damage aren’t just cosmetic – they trap debris and can grow into larger holes that weaken the concrete shell [9].

"Pitting is more than just an eyesore. These craters can mess with your feet, your pool brush, and your overall good vibes. If you ignore them, these spots can grow, letting water sneak under the shell and cause bigger headaches – think crumbling concrete or peeling plaster." – Mia Remodeling Contractors [9]

What starts as a few small imperfections can quickly snowball into widespread damage, making total replastering unavoidable. Addressing these issues promptly is essential to maintaining your pool’s integrity.

Structural Damage and Water Leaks

When pool plaster begins to fail, it loses its watertight seal. This allows water to seep in, potentially damaging the pool’s structure over time [5]. Small cracks can grow into larger fractures, leading to significant leaks and even damage to the surrounding pool deck [2][10].

"If you don’t replaster after your pool plaster shows signs of failing, you will notice an increase in cracking and leaking, which could result in structural damage over time." – Ralph Tarulli, Pools and Construction Expert, The Spruce [5]

Exposed concrete is particularly vulnerable. Without the protective plaster layer, pool chemicals can attack the concrete directly, accelerating its deterioration. If the foundation becomes compromised, structural repairs could cost upwards of $30,000 [5]. The longer you wait, the more expensive and extensive the repairs become, turning what could have been a manageable fix into a financial headache.

Higher Maintenance and Chemical Costs

Worn plaster creates tiny pits that trap algae and debris, making cleaning and maintenance more time-consuming and expensive [4][11]. A resurfaced pool, on the other hand, can cut chemical costs by about 30% [4]. As plaster deteriorates, it begins to dissolve into the water, a process called chalking. This raises the pool’s pH levels, forcing you to use additional acid to restore chemical balance [4][11]. Every gallon of water lost to leaks or evaporation also requires rebalancing, which further drives up costs [3][4][11].

Safety Hazards and Poor Appearance

The consequences of delaying replastering extend beyond maintenance and repair bills. Rough, sandpaper-like plaster can cause injuries to swimmers and damage swimsuits. It also detracts from your pool’s appearance, reducing its overall value and appeal [2][3][4]. Around 70% of pool owners wait for a major failure before resurfacing, but this can be a costly mistake [4]. Choosing the right pool resurfacing materials early can prevent these issues. Homes with freshly resurfaced pools often sell for about 7% more than those with older, deteriorated finishes [10].

How Pool Replastering Works

Replastering a pool usually takes about 1–2 weeks, though factors like weather and pool size can influence the timeline [14].

The Replastering Process Step by Step

The process starts with a professional inspection. Once that’s done, the pool is drained using a submersible pump, which takes 1–2 days. In areas with high water tables, an additional main drain pump may be used to counteract hydrostatic pressure [12][5].

Next comes surface preparation. Crews remove any loose plaster and use sand- or hydro-blasting to create a rough surface that ensures the new plaster adheres properly [12]. Deep cracks are filled with hydraulic cement or epoxy, and hollow spots are patched to restore the pool’s structure. A bonding agent is applied to prevent peeling or separation, and this bond coat needs 8 to 10 hours to dry before the new plaster is applied [5].

The new plaster material – whether it’s standard plaster, quartz, or pebble – is mixed on-site and applied by spraying or troweling. Crews work within a 4 to 6-hour window to avoid visible seams [12]. For quartz or pebble finishes, the top cement layer is lightly acid-washed to expose the decorative stones or crystals [4].

Once the new finish is in place, the pool is refilled without interruption until the water reaches the mid-tile line. Stopping mid-fill can result in permanent "bathtub rings" [1]. During the first 30 days, the surface must be brushed twice daily, and pH, alkalinity, and calcium levels should be carefully maintained to prevent staining. The filtration system should run continuously for the first 72 hours to 7 days to capture plaster dust [13].

Plaster Material Options

The type of plaster you choose will impact both the cost and how long it lasts:

  • Standard white plaster: Costs $3–$5 per square foot, or $5,000–$7,000 total, and lasts 5–10 years. It offers a smooth, classic look but is more prone to staining and chemical damage, especially in warm climates like Miami [4].
  • Quartz finishes: Priced at $7–$10 per square foot, or $8,000–$12,000 total, and lasts 10–15 years. The blend of quartz crystals and plaster creates a sparkling surface that resists stains, UV damage, and etching [4].
  • Pebble finishes: Costs $8–$12 per square foot, or $10,000–$15,000 total, and lasts 15–25 years. Made with small river stones, this finish offers a natural, slip-resistant texture that hides stains well. However, it may feel rough on sensitive feet [4].
  • Glass tile: Ranges from $15–$75 per square foot and can last 20–30+ years. This non-porous option resists algae, doesn’t fade under sunlight, and is one of the easiest to clean and maintain [1].

Timeline for Replastering

Replastering generally requires 10–14 days: 2–4 days for draining and preparation, 1–3 days for application, and 2–5 days for curing and refilling. Swimming can usually resume 3–7 days after refilling, once the water’s chemical balance is restored [14][13].

However, a 30-day intensive care period follows. During this time, avoid using the pool heater for at least 3 weeks, as early heating can cause calcium scaling that might stain the new surface permanently [13]. Robotic cleaners and automatic vacuums should also be kept out of the pool for at least 28 days to protect the fresh plaster [5]. If you have a saltwater system, wait 28–30 days before adding salt to allow the finish to fully cure [1].

In South Florida, the best time to replaster is between October and February. Cooler temperatures during these months help the plaster cure more evenly, reducing the risk of cracks. Avoid the rainy season, as high humidity and heavy rain can delay drying and curing [14].

When to Schedule a Professional Inspection

If you notice any signs of plaster deterioration, it’s time to call in a licensed pool contractor. Waiting too long can increase repair costs by up to 30% [4].

Before reaching out to a professional, take a few steps yourself. Start by documenting the damage with clear photos of cracks, stains, or peeling areas [15]. Then, perform a couple of simple tests. First, try the chalk test – run your hand along the pool wall; if you see white residue, it’s a sign of active plaster deterioration. Next, do a bucket test: place a bucket filled with water on a pool step, mark the water level inside the bucket, and compare it to the pool’s water level after 24 hours. If the pool’s water level drops more than the bucket’s, you might have a leak [4][15].

A professional inspection is vital for identifying common pool repairs and structural problems before they escalate into emergencies. In South Florida, the best time to schedule this inspection is between October and February, as the cooler weather creates ideal conditions for replastering [4].
